In a last-minute move ahead of the three-match ODI series against the West Indies, the Indian team has decided to rest fast bowler Mohammed Siraj and flown him back home as part of workload management, as reported by ESPNcricinfo.

India's series-levelling win against England at the ACA-VDCA Stadium was boosted by Rohit Sharma's team's ability to withstand England's aggressive approach. The pitch did not trouble the batters, despite Jasprit Bumrah's reverse swing. England's failure to play long innings and Zak Crawley's dismissal by Kuldeep Yadav revived India's hopes.
